Unassertive
A behavioral characteristic in which an individual tends to be passive or submissive, often failing to express their own opinions or needs.
Interpersonal Conflict
A disagreement or clash between individuals due to differing opinions, values, or interests.
Conflict Management
The process of identifying and addressing differences that have the potential to escalate into disputes, in a constructive manner.
Conflict Handling Style
An individual's preferred method of dealing with disagreements, ranging from avoidance to direct confrontation.
